搜索
 找回密码
 立即注册

Linux Kangle一键脚本,支持极速,编译,KangleCDN.3种模式安装

博主: Gitkk 实名认证  官方认证  9·15 2022 00:02:29投稿 热度480K+
Gitkk ·地理:四川成都
脚本简介

Kangle一键脚本,是一款可以一键安装Kangle+Easypanel+MySQL+PHP集合的Linux脚本。 脚本本身集成:PHP5.3~8.1、MYSQL5.6~8.0,支持极速安装和编译安装2种模式,支持CDN专属安装模式。同时也对Easypanel面板进行了大量优化。



脚本特点

有国内和国外2个文件下载节点,提升安装速度
自带Kangle商业版最新版本免费使用
支持EP前台自由切换PHP5.3-8.1
安装前可选MySQL5.6、5.7、8.0版本
预先设置各PHP版本PHP.ini安全问题
安装前可自定义数据库密码,避免安装完成后再设置的麻烦
支持自定义403.404.503.504等错误页面
脚本中可切换其它几套EP用户后台模板
脚本中集成Linux工具箱,可一键更换Yum源、更换DNS、设置Swap、同步时间、清理垃圾等
修改kangle二进制文件以提升错误页加载速度



EP基于原版的优化内容

0.EP源码全解密并升级smarty框架
1.SSL证书可同步到cdn节点
2.SSL配置页面新增"HTTP跳转到HTTPS"选项
3.SSL配置页面新增"开启HTTP2"选项
4.CDN主机可以给单个域名设置SSL证书
5.增加独立的PHP版本切换页面
6.EP管理员后台增加选项:默认PHP版本、允许域名泛绑定
7.修复带有空格的文件名无法解压和重命名的问题
9.CDN绑定域名可以自定义回源协议,增加tcp四层转发
10.优化防CC设置页面,支持设置IP白名单
11.清除缓存页面支持批量清除
12.支持设置url黑名单
13.绑定域名页面新增编辑按钮
* EP升级方法:脚本主菜单选择单独安装/更新组件,然后选择更新Easypanel



支持的系统

CentOS 7(推荐)
CentOS 8
CentOS Stream 8
Rocky Linux 8
AlmaLinux 8
CentOS 6(不支持安装PHP7.4及以上版本)



安装方式

请复制以下指令到ssh连接软件粘贴执行
游客,如果您要查看本帖隐藏内容请回复

SSH远程Linux管理系统中输入以上脚本后,会出现下图!
11.jpg
选择2. 安装全部 Kangle/Easypanel/PHP (CDN专用)

2.png
然后选择1

3.jpg
见到上图提示后,根据需要选择,如果只是做CDN服务器,推荐选择2

4.png
见到上图后,表示安装完成,

Kangle中的设置步骤

登录后台后初始化服务器,勾选所有
新建产品-类型选择CDN-显示高级模式-端口填写80,443s(不然无法添加ssl证书)
新增网站-产品名称选择刚才新建的产品
新建号后就可以进入后台进行管理-点击网站名称进入后台
新增网站-点击域名绑定
填写域名和源站ip-回源协议按照自身网站进行填写
部署ssl证书,并开启http跳转https
到DNS解析面板添加域名解析-解析到CDN节点ip
CDN节点部署成功-并且可以正常访问-显示是CDN节点ip

使用道具 举报

0 回复

高级模式
游客